Job Overview

A law firm seeks an Associate Attorney in Boca Raton, FL, with expertise in litigation. The ideal candidate will demonstrate initiative, excel in courtroom settings, and manage legal cases effectively. Experience in behavioral health law is preferred but not required.

Duties

  • Provide expert legal representation in matters related to the Marchman Act and guardianship.
  • Conduct legal research and analysis for comprehensive case understanding.
  • Prepare and file legal documents, petitions, and motions.
  • Attend court hearings and proceedings on behalf of clients.
  • Prepare clients for court hearings and present compelling arguments.
  • Engage in negotiations and settlements when appropriate.
  • Communicate effectively with clients to understand their needs.
  • Collaborate with attorneys, legal professionals, and external stakeholders.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ant laws and ethical standards.
  • Maintain accurate case files and documentation.
  • Stay informed about developments in guardianship and behavioral health law.

Requirements

  •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Admission to the state bar in Florida.
  • 3-5 years of experience in litigation.
  • Proven courtroom experience.
  • Strong research, writing, and analytical skills.
  • Excellent communication and negotiation sk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
